区块链的八大特性全面解析

区块链技术自其诞生以来,迅速被应用于各个行业。它是一种新型的分布式账本技术,具有众多独特的特性。理解这些特性对我们进一步利用和开发区块链技术具有重要意义。本文将深入探讨区块链的八大特性,并分析其如何影响各行各业的发展。

1. 去中心化

区块链的核心特性之一是去中心化。在传统的中心化体系中,所有的信息和数据都存储在一个中心服务器上,由中心机构进行管理。而区块链技术通过分布式网络架构,使得信息和数据分散存储在网络中的每一个节点上。这种去中心化的设计减少了单点故障的风险,提高了系统的稳定性。

去中心化带来的一个重要好处是防止了控制权的集中。用户不需要依赖第三方来执行交易或验证信息,从而降低了潜在的欺诈风险。此外,去中心化还避免了数据被单一实体篡改的可能性,使得信息更加可信。

2. 不可篡改

区块链上所有的数据一旦写入后,就无法被修改或删除,这是其不可篡改性的体现。这一特性源自区块链的加密技术和共识机制。每个区块都包含上一个区块的哈希值,这使得任何试图篡改信息的行为都将导致整个链条的改变,从而被网络中的其他节点轻易识别。

这种不可篡改性在多个领域都具有重要的意义,例如金融交易、身份验证及数据存储等。通过保证信息的完整性,区块链可以提高操作的透明度和用户的信任度,从而在一些信任机制薄弱的场合发挥重要作用。

3. 透明性

区块链技术的透明性意味着任何人都可以查看链上的交易记录。在开放的区块链网络中,用户可以访问公共账本,验证交易的真实情况,这增强了系统的信任感。相比传统数据库,区块链的所有交易都是公开可查的,所有节点都拥有相同的数据副本,这样就减少了信息的不对称,增强了各方的信任。

这种透明性对于监管机构和消费者尤为重要。监管机构可以通过区块链实现实时监控,而消费者也能更清楚地了解到他们的资金流向,用以保障自身的权益。此外,在慈善和公共资源管理中,区块链的透明性能够有效减少腐败,提高资源的使用效率。

4. 安全性

区块链提供了相对传统系统更高的安全性。每个区块通过复杂的密码学算法实现加密,而区块之间又通过哈希链接形成链条。这种设计使得数据被篡改的难度极大,从而提高了系统的整体安全性。

并且,由于区块链数据在多个节点上进行分布存储,攻击者必须同时控制大多数节点才能进行篡改,这在现实中几乎是不可能的。此外,区块链还通过共识机制确保了网络中节点达成一致意见进行交易确认,这进一步加强了安全性。干扰或破坏网络的行为也会遭遇网络用户的反制作用,从而形成保护。

5. 分布式存储

区块链采用分布式存储模式,不同于传统的集中式存储。每个参与节点都持有完整的数据副本,这样即便个别节点出现故障,网络整体依旧可以正常运作。分布式存储的好处在于减少了数据丢失的风险,提升了数据的可用性和抗攻击能力。

在数据管理方面,分布式存储还允许用户对数据加强控制,用户不再依赖单一的数据提供商,而是能够使用去中心化的网络进行数据交换。这种方式可以降低存储成本并提高访问速度。特别是在大数据和云计算的背景下,分布式存储的优势将愈加显现。

6. 共识机制

共识机制是区块链中用于确认交易的协议,确保网络中的各个节点对数据状态达成一致。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。通过这些机制,区块链能够在没有中央权威的情况下实现多个参与者之间的合作。

共识机制的稳定与安全性直接关系到区块链网络的健康。一个有效的共识机制能够防止恶意行为和叉链的出现。例如,工作量证明通过要求计算复杂的数学题,能确保网络中的节点在记账过程中的诚信与安全。而权益证明则以经济利益作为驱动,鼓励用户诚实地参与网络维护。

7. 智能合约

智能合约是指在区块链上自动执行的合约代码,它能够在特定条件被满足时自动执行。智能合约使得人们能够在没有第三方的情况下自定义协议并实现交易的自动化,进而提升交易的效率并减少人为错误。

智能合约在众多领域都有着潜在的应用,例如在金融服务解除传统中介的需求,使交易更加迅速和便捷。在供应链管理中,智能合约则可以自动跟踪和记录产品的流转情况,以确保透明度和库存管理。通过智能合约,区块链技术推动了自动化的革命,形成了一种新的商业逻辑。

8. 可扩展性

可扩展性指区块链网络在用户或交易量增加时是否能有效提升性能。虽然一些早期的区块链例如比特币因其设计局限而表现出可扩展性不足的问题,但新的区块链项目正在通过各种手段改进这方面的不足。

可扩展性的提升通常依赖于技术创新,例如分片技术、侧链及Layer 2 解决方案等能够有效分散交易负载,提高网络的整体处理能力。而在未来,随着越来越多的用户和应用接入区块链网络,如何解决可扩展性成为科研和工业界必须共同面对的挑战。

常见问题

1. 区块链技术如何保障数据隐私?

在区块链上,数据虽然透明可查但并不意味着所有数据都是公开的。区块链技术通过多种方式来保障数据隐私。首先,信息记录在区块链上时,通常采用加密算法,使得数据在传输及存储过程中无法被轻易读取。其次,通过使用非对称密钥,用户的身份和交易信息可以得到隐蔽,而只有交易双方及必要的节点才能进行解密。

此外,基于零知识证明等技术,区块链的用户可以在保证数据隐私的前提下进行信息的验证。零知识证明允许在不披露秘密信息的情况下进行验证,这对于身份认证和确保交易的合法性具有重要意义。而隐私链(如Monero、Zcash等)直接在设计上集中于保护交易隐私,允许用户在需要时保持匿名。

2. 区块链技术能应用于哪些行业?

区块链技术因其独特的特性,应用领域非常广泛。首先,在金融行业,区块链被应用于跨境支付、智能合约贷、证券交易等方面,使得资金流转更加透明和高效。同时也在银行的清算与结算、数字资产管理等方面得到了深入应用。

其次,在供应链领域,区块链可以用于各环节的透明追踪,确保商品从生产到消费的每个步骤均有记录可查,这对于食品安全和奢侈品行业尤其重要。此外,区块链在医疗健康、安全认证、数字身份、物联网等领域也展现出了巨大的应用潜力,从而提升了各行业的运营效率和透明度。

3. 区块链的实施面临哪些挑战?

虽然区块链技术具有诸多潜力,但其实施过程中仍面临许多挑战。首先,技术本身的复杂性使得需要具备高水平的技术人才进行开发与维护。其次,区块链网络的可扩展性问题在高交易量情况下,面对网络拥堵。因此必须在设计时就考虑如何处理大量数据而不影响性能。

另一大挑战来自于法规与合规。许多国家和地区对区块链及加密货币的监管政策尚不明确,企业在实施时难免受到政策风险。此外,与其他遗留系统的兼容性也是一个不容忽视的问题。现有商业模型的重构及需要参与者的广泛合作与共识,不然将使实施的推行受阻。

4. 区块链的未来发展趋势是什么?

未来区块链技术的发展趋势主要体现在几个方面。技术层面上,随着共识机制和隐私保护技术的不断创新,区块链的性能将大幅提升。尤其是Layer 2解决方案将解决可扩展性问题,让区块链在大用户基础条件下仍能保持高效。

应用层面上,预计区块链技术将更深入地渗透到各行各业,例如金融服务、医疗、公共服务、物联网等,提升各行业的效率和透明度。此外,区块链与人工智能、物联网等新兴技术的融合也将带来更多创新应用,例如在数据流通、身份认证等领域可以实现更自动化和可靠的解决方案。

5. 如何选择合适的区块链项目进行投资?

投资区块链项目,需要从多个角度进行考量。首先,要了解区块链项目的目标和应用场景。一个有明确愿景和强大应用前景的项目,往往更具有投资价值。其次,考察项目开发团队及其在区块链领域的经验也是至关重要的,团队的专业性和执行力直接关系到项目的成功概率。

此外,投资者还需要关注项目的技术路线图和发展计划。要判断其是否能在预定时间内实现具体的技术发展目标。社区的活跃度及用户支持也时常反映一个项目的受欢迎程度和可靠性。最后,务必考虑项目的合规性,确保你的投资行为符合当地法律法规,以降低法律风险。

总之,区块链技术以其独特的特性,正在为各行各业带来变革。随着技术的发展和应用的普及,未来区块链将为我们的生活和工作方式带来更深远的改变。